HR & Training Manager
2 weeks ago
Location: Remote working with onsite attendance for company meetings in Bristol 1 day every month Salary: to £50k DOE Hours: 37.5 hours per week, Monday – Friday Benefits: 25 days holiday, birthday off, pension, £50 per month work from home allowance, PERKBOX employee benefits, discretionary company bonus, 4 days bookable training days on top of work-related training PLEASE NOTE YOU MUST DRIVE FOR THIS ROLE Aspire Jobs are working exclusively with our client who are a software company that are just about to go through a period of growth. They are now bringing their HR & Training inhouse and therefore are looking for a CIPD level 5 qualified HR & Training Manager. The role is standalone and reports to the CEO. With a 50 / 50 split of HR and Training you will have experience of both. The successful HR & Training Manager will CIPD level 5 or QBE Confidence to implement performance plans where needed Confident to deal with employment law changes Strong grounding in UK HR employment law Demonstrated track record in employee relations casework and risk management Experience in assessing, designing and implementing learning & development strategies Strong coaching skills, with the ability to influence and develop managers Excellent communication skills with a pragmatic, solutions-oriented approach Must drive and have own transport Be a natural leader who is self-motivated, determined and committed to delivering outcomes Commercially minded with a people-first approach Confident, approachable, relationship builder who is able to inspire trust Knowledge of digital learning platforms and LMS tools Exposure to scaling businesses’ (SME or high-growth environments) would be desirable Responsibilities Employment Law & Compliance Ensure compliance with all relevant employment legislation, including contracts, policies, working time, equality, GDPR, and health & safety Provide proactive advice and reactive support for employee relations cases (disciplinaries, grievances, redundancies, TUPE, etc.) Develop, maintain, and communicate clear HR policies and procedures aligned with best practice and business needs Act as the point of escalation for complex HR matters, advising senior leaders on risk and resolution Manager Coaching & Leadership Development Partner with managers to build their confidence in handling people-related matters, offering coaching and guidance to support effective decision-making Deliver training to leaders on key HR topics such as performance management, process / operational matters, and employee engagement Support leadership capability development through tailored workshops and ongoing coaching conversations Assist the CEO in creation, maintenance and planning of a clear succession strategy Learning Culture & Organisational Development Define and implement the company’s learning strategy, ensuring it supports both technical excellence (software, data enrichment expertise) and soft skills (leadership, communication, customer excellence) Establish frameworks for continuous learning, from onboarding through to career progression, making learning part of everyday practice Employee Experience & Engagement Act as a cultural ambassador, embedding their 4 key values and behaviours that align with the company’s vision Design initiatives to enhance employee engagement, retention, and career development - ensuring their successful implementations #J-18808-Ljbffr
